Royal Enfield Continental GT Cup Announced

Royal Enfield has officially announced the 2025 edition of the Continental GT Cup, continuing its effort to promote motorcycle racing in India. First launched in 2021, the championship has become a key platform for young, amateur, and professional riders. Organised by the Chennai-based motorcycle brand, this year’s edition will be held across eight cities—Chennai, Mumbai, Delhi NCR, Bengaluru, Pune, Guwahati, Hyderabad, and Ahmedabad. The Continental GT Cup 2025 is open to both amateur and professional participants. Interested riders can register online. Each city will host a two-day zonal round. On the first day, riders will receive training from the Royal Enfield Track School. The second day will feature timed trials, allowing racers to qualify for the national finals. This setup helps riders develop their skills before moving to the next stage.

After the zonal rounds, 64 amateur riders and 50 professionals will be shortlisted for the final selection. This final round will be held at the Kari Motor Speedway in Coimbatore from 3rd to 6th July 2025. Only the 24 fastest riders will earn a place on the final racing grid.

CITY  VENUEDATES
GuwahatiWarisa Estate, Sonapur10-May to 11-May
Noida  Formula 11 Track17-May to 18-May
Ahmedabad  Indikarting24-May to 25-May
Mumbai  Fortune Karting Raceway Hakone31-May to 1-Jun
Pune Kartdrome7-Jun to 8-Jun
Hyderabad Chicane Circuit 14-Jun to 15-Jun
Bangalore  Meco Kartopia21-Jun to 22-Jun
Chennai ECR Speedway Race Track28-Jun to 29-Jun

The event will continue its Pro-Am race format, where amateurs and professionals compete on the same track. The popular Twin-Power Trophy will also return. It matches each amateur with a professional rider, creating a mentoring opportunity and improving race performance for newcomers.

All racers will compete on identical, track-ready GT-R650 motorcycles provided by Royal Enfield. This ensures a level playing field, where results depend on rider skill, strategy, and focus. With its expanded city reach and rider-friendly format, the Royal Enfield Continental GT Cup 2025 aims to support India’s growing motorcycle racing community and discover new talent.
